Output e659715b1155c9cfe9dfd454bc5d1084b8a0126f0f1ca00dfdafa21e3149509c:2

value
24941
script pubkey
OP_0 OP_PUSHBYTES_20 6ec58c1471ea138f6dd07e7a055d368c88fa4fd4
address
bc1qdmzcc9r3agfc7mws0eaq2hfk3jy05n75pn2xzd
transaction
e659715b1155c9cfe9dfd454bc5d1084b8a0126f0f1ca00dfdafa21e3149509c
confirmations
34723
spent
true